Costs very little to polish headlight lenses if you’re willing put put a bit of effort in.  Water and a few sheets of wet and dry sandpaper  

I used to split VW headlights to paint the reflectors black. I used to bake them in the oven for a few minutes. Softens the glue enough to separate them with no damage.
